Checking the brake pedal position (Mondeo 4)

            0

The correct position of the brake pedal in a free state and when pressing it to the stop (pedal working travel) serves as one of the criteria for checking the serviceability of the brake system. At the same time, the position of the pedal largely ensures the proper operation of the system. If the pedal is located at a distance from the floor that is greater than the standard, incomplete release of the wheels is possible when releasing the pedal (usually there is no free pedal travel). If the pedal is too low, the effectiveness of the brakes may decrease due to a decrease in the pedal working travel. Adjustment of the pedal position is not provided; it is provided structurally if all brake drive parts are in good condition. In case of deviation from the nominal position, check the condition of all drive parts and assemblies and replace faulty ones.

You will need a ruler.

1. Start the engine, let it idle and press the brake pedal vigorously several times.

2. Pull the brake pedal up with your hand until it stops.

3. Release the pedal and measure the distance from the pedal pad to the floor.

NOTE: The ruler must be installed perpendicular to the floor plane.




4. Press the brake pedal firmly until it stops.

5. Release the pedal and re-measure the distance from the pedal pad to the floor in a free state. The pedal should return to its original position at the distance measured in step 3 from the pedal pad to the floor.

6. Check the free travel of the brake pedal by moving the pedal by hand until the pedal stops moving without resistance. Determine the free travel value using a ruler; it should be 1–3 mm. If the free travel does not correspond to the specified range of values, this may be due to the following reasons: – increased play in the connection between the vacuum booster pusher fork and the pedal. This may be due to wear on the fork pin; - pistons seizing in the main brake cylinder; – jamming of the plunger in the brake booster.

7. If the distance from the pedal pad to the floor during repeated measurement (item 5) is less than the value measured in item 2, this indicates that the pedal is stuck on the axle, that the pistons in the working and master cylinders are jammed, or that the compensation holes in the master brake cylinder are clogged.

NOTE: The expansion holes in the master cylinder may be blocked by seals that have swollen due to petroleum products entering the system, or due to the use of low-quality brake fluid.


8. If the pedal stops almost at the floor when pressed, this indicates that there is air in the brake hydraulic system or that the brake pads, brake discs or drums are worn to the limit. If there is air in the system, the pedal will stop further from the floor when pressed several times ("pumps up").

WARNING: If the pedal gradually moves toward the floor after being pressed all the way and held in this position, there is a hydraulic fluid leak or the master brake cylinder is faulty. These faults are very dangerous, so immediately find the leak and fix it or replace the master brake cylinder!
